Northwest Medical Center Springdale
Detailed report on the hospital located in Springdale, Arkansas (AR).
Northwest Medical Center Springdale is a for-profit acute care hospital based at 609 West Maple Avenue in Springdale, AR. The facility is accredited and provides emergency services. The mortality rate for heart attack patients at the facility is no different than the national rate. The patient mortality rate is also no different than the national rate. In 2006, a total of 2,255 Medicare patients were given 14,804 days of PPS inpatient care and services. The provider was reimbursed $24,168,674 by Medicare for those services. In 2006, 296 Medicare patients were given 4,176 days of Non-PPS inpatient care and services.
When compared to other hospitals in the state, surgery patients at this hospital are less likely to have their preventitve antibiotics stopped within 24 hours after surgery.

Springdale at a Glance
Springdale has a total population of 45,798, of which 13,287 are children under the age of 18 and 4,692 are seniors 65 and older. The median age is 31.0.
